Great winery with a diverse choice of wines. While not on some of the Finger Lake winery tourist type maps, this winery is one of the best you will find in any part of the wine areas in New York. Located on the Western shore of Cayuga Lake, Sheldrake Point Winery is the real deal in chateau style wine making. They grow the grapes right here. They have a great mix of varietals and an extensive tasting selection. Have a group, no problem. Seating is available both inside and out. They have older, Library, selections for both tasting and purchase. Try their Gamay Noirs for something quite different than the usual white wine choices everywhere else. Of course they have exceptional Reisling wines in a sweetness or dryness that will delight your senses so, you are covered in the "usual" choices available all over the Finger Lakes. Want a hearty red? You can get a very good bottle of Cabernet Sauvignon and a meritage too. Their largest selling wine is a Rose' in case you want some cool looking wine for your next party. Lots to like about this place and I'm very sure you too will both like your visit and then look forward to coming back for more.
